Classical Recordings Review - Cantate Domino
Written by RICHARD TODD, OTTAWA CITIZEN | Friday, January 13 2012 00:00

Ottawa Citizen

 

Cantate Domino 4.5 stars

Ottawa Bach Choir, Lisette Canton, conductor (Canto)

January 13, 2012

This season marks the 10th anni­versary of the Ottawa Bach Choir and the release of this CD is part of the celebrations. It begins and ends with the music of J.S. Bach, Cantata no. 196 and the motet Der Geist hilft unsrer Schwachheit auf respectively, and includes music by Monteverdi, Buxtehude and Messiaen among others. In addition to authoritative and beautiful accounts of the Bach works, Monteverdi’s Cantate Domino and Messiaen’s O sacrum convivium! are especially enjoyable, but there are no weak performances in this impressive retrospective.

Anton Kwiatkowski’s audio engineering is entirely worthy of all the splendid singing and instrumental playing.

— Richard Todd
